TEACHING EXPERIENCE

I've been teaching for 27 years, and I love it even more now than when I started. I think you have to establish a positive relationship with a student first. Only then can you begin to ask for their trust and attention.

MY TEACHING STYLE

I use laughter and love to nurture the soul, and know that a thought provoking question is worth so much more than an answer. I often combine project based learning with intense literary analysis. My students get up out of their chairs, move, discuss, plan, revise, and create. I'm a visual learner, so I enjoy incorporating visual elements into my lessons. I try to appeal to the "whole" student. Good lessons should be engaging. When they say, "Is class over already?" I know that they enjoyed themselves while they were learning.
